    Is your wife a Greek or a Cypriot citizen?

    If your wife is a citizen of Greece [i.e. the Hellenic Republic], then Greek law does not automatically confer Greek citizenship to you, the husband. You would have to naturalize. The law does allow for you to have an easier time to naturalize if a) you live in Greece, and b) have a child with your wife. If that is the case, you can apply within three years of your wedding. Otherwise, you have to live in Greece for 10 of the 12 years preceding your naturalization application. You would also have to pass a Greek language test, etc.

    If your wife is a citizen of the Cyprus Republic, then I am not aware of the process to become a Cypriot citizen.
